Bass: Press

/

to adjust the bass setting.

Treble: Press

/

to adjust the treble setting.

Balance: Press

/

to adjust the audio between the left and right

speakers.

Fade: Press

/

to adjust the audio between the front and rear

speakers.

Speed sensitive volume: Radio volume automatically changes slightly

with vehicle speed to compensate for road and wind noise. Use

/

to adjust. Recommended level is 1–3. Level 0 (SPEED OFF) turns the
feature off and level 7 is the maximum setting.

Occupancy mode: Use

/

to select and optimize sound for ALL

SEATS, DRIVERS SEAT or REAR SEATS.

Track/Folder Mode: Available only on MP3 discs in CD mode.

Press

/

to toggle between Track and Folder mode.

In Track mode, press

SEEK

to scroll through all tracks on the

current disc.
In Folder mode, press

SEEK

to scroll through tracks within the

selected folder.

Compression: Brings soft and loud CD passages together for a more
consistent listening level when in CD mode. Press MENU until
compression status is displayed. Press

/

to turn the feature on/off.

4. AUX: Press to toggle between
FES/DVD, AUX and Satellite Radio
modes (if equipped). If no auxiliary
sources are available, NO AUX AUDIO will be displayed.. To return to
radio mode, press AM/FM.
If equipped with Satellite Radio, press AUX to cycle through SAT1, SAT2
and SAT3 modes.
Satellite radio is available only in the continental United States.
